Kwara Express receives 42 new buses

Date: 2015-06-03

The Group Managing Director, Harmony Holdings Limited, Mr. Tope Daramola, has said that the HHL has procured 42 new buses for the Kwara State Transport Corporation, popularly called the Kwara Express.

He stated that the injection of the new buses into the transport scheme was to improve the operational efficiency of the transport company.

In an interview with The Punch correspondent in Ilorin, the Kwara State capital, on Tuesday, Daramola said that the HHL had invested about N.5bn in the Kwara Express with the procurement of the buses and the injection of another N170m into the scheme to revamp the transport company.

"We got the 42 buses as part of the Federal Government's mass transit programme anchored by the Infrastructure Bank. Our partners, which also include Sterling Bank, provided corporate guarantee for the purchase.

"The injection of the 42 buses is part of the retooling of the entire corporation's operational modalities. We mean well for the Kwara Express.

It is not meant to be destroyed or killed. We will do the best to perform the mandate that the Governor, Alhaji Abdulfatah Ahmed, has given to us, which is to make sure that we turn around the company. If you add the cost of the buses to the total debt of the company, the money is close to half a billion naira," he said.

Daramola said the HHL planned to make the Kwara Express a world-class transport business, functional, efficient and well managed.

He said that the transport company would also be able to add value in terms comfort and safety while travelling from Ilorin to other parts of this country and from other parts of the country to the state.

He said, "It is a company that will compete very well with its peers, even in the private sector. The brand name is there. The brand is strong. We have a lot of core staff members that are great assets to the company. We have the requisite knowledge and experience as they have been around for awhile.

"We will leverage on these assets and benefit that we know that are already there and bring other competencies from outside and from then be sure that this company becomes one of the best in the country. We have also integrated the e-ticket system into our accounting modules in such a way that as you are selling ticket, it will be appearing on our system so that we can know what money is going in and what is coming out. In the normal fleet management, we can track our buses, know where they are and have a fast recovery of the vehicles where there are incidents or issues."

The GMD said the HHL, which has been the supervising body for the Kwara Express since the inception, met a completely collapsed transport company allegedly due to mismanagement.

He added that the morale of the workers was very low as the company could not pay their salaries and allowances; neither could it meet its financial obligations to the state government.

Daramola said, "It was a completely pathetic situation. So, we brought our knowledge to bear, restructured the company into operational system and rejuvenated its basic assets.

"As of the time we got there, the bankers were already tired. They were on the verge of recovering and foreclosing on these buses. As a matter fact, as of the time we had contact with the Infrastructure Bank, they had concluded plans to go for repositioning with Sterling Bank. But we stepped in, restructured, and renegotiated these things. We are happy that we have remedied the situation that is why we are able to get loan for 42 buses."
